How to Maintain Your Variable Lift Bed
An modifiable lift bed needs particular attention to keep its usability and longevity. Routine maintenance requires checking mechanical parts for wear and tear, guaranteeing that moving components run smoothly. It is advisable to periodically inspect the motor and remote control to confirm they are functioning correctly and to replace batteries as required.
It is just as crucial to clean the bed frame and mattress. A soft wipe with a wet cloth removes dust and grime, and vacuuming the mattress works to eliminate allergens. Using a fabric cleaner on fabric-covered mattresses can preserve their appearance.
Additionally, it is important to avoid loading too much weight onto the bed with a heavy load, as this can strain the lifting mechanism. Following the manufacturer's weight guidelines ensures optimal function. Finally, consider placing the remote control in a designated location to prevent losing it, facilitating ease of use when modifying the bed's position.

Frequently Requested Items
Can Convertible Elevation Beds Work with All Types of Mattresses?
Adjustable lift beds are generally suitable for various mattress types, such as foam, latex, and hybrid. However, innerspring mattresses might require careful consideration given their design, which can affect functionality and support on adjustable bases.
How a great deal of mass can an adjustable lift bed support?
Adjustable lift beds usually support between 400 and 800 pounds, depending on the model and construction. It is necessary to consult the manufacturer's specifications to verify compatibility with certain mattress types and overall weight capacity.
Do Adjustable Lift Beds Call for Tailored Bedding?
Adjustable lift beds usually do not require special bedding; however, using mattresses intended for adjustable bases boosts relaxation and utility. It is recommended to pick bendable materials that can accommodate the bed's movements properly.
Can you find protective options for customizable lift beds?
Often, adjustable lift beds come with safety devices such as locking mechanisms, weight sensors, and emergency stop buttons. These elements are intended to avoid accidents and guarantee user safety during bed adjustments and positioning.
Can Adjustable Lift Beds Be Disassembled for Relocating?
Yes, adjustable lift beds can typically be taken apart for moving. Most models feature interchangeable components, allowing for easier transportation. However, it's advisable to consult the manufacturer’s guidelines for specific disassembly instructions and safety precautions.
